Cast
Jodi Benson as Ariel / Vanessa (voice); Samuel E. Wright as Sebastian (voice); Pat Carroll as Ursula (voice); Christopher Daniel Barnes as Prince Eric (voice); Kenneth Mars as King Triton (voice); Buddy Hackett as Scuttle (voice); Jason Marin as Flounder (voice); René Auberjonois as Louis (voice)
About The Little Mermaid
This colorful adventure tells the story of an impetuous mermaid princess named Ariel who falls in love with the very human Prince Eric and puts everything on the line for the chance to be with him. Memorable songs and characters -- including the villainous sea witch Ursula.
